Service Description: Women's Centre in Minden - Women Helping Women. The YWCA Women's Centre offers referrals and advocacy, a lending library, information and literature on other community support services, health and well being programs for women, volunteer opportunities * Outreach support workers provide crisis intervention, support, advocacy and information to women experiencing abuse.


SAFE SPACE AND SUPPORT PROGRAM offers help with safety planning, finding and maintaining housing, accompaniment to appointments, achieving your goals - short and long term planning, support and encouragement, information and referrals to: Ontario Works and ODSP, Legal Aid, lawyers and courts, programs for children, job training, counselling and education. Call the YWCA Transitional Support Worker (Mon-Fri) at the Women's Centre in Minden to make an appointment. Home visits and transportation needs are considered. Confidentiality assured.
